What Are PDF to CAD Drawing Conversion Services?

Essentially, the idea of PDF to CAD is about taking a document that is not easily editable by the engineer/designer and making it usable.

PDF files are of two types: vector PDFs, which are created by CAD software, and raster PDFs, which are created by scanning the drawings.

In some cases, vector PDFs may be converted into CAD files like DWG/DXF. In other cases, the PDF may need tracing, i.e., the design needs to be recreated with the same dimensions as the original design.

Why Converting PDF to CAD Improves Drawing Accuracy

Eliminates Manual Redrawing Errors

Manual drafting from PDFs sounds straightforward, but it rarely is.

Scaling issues creep in. Lines don’t align perfectly. Small measurement errors accumulate. And before you know it, the drawing looks right—but isn’t actually accurate.

With proper PDF to DWG conversion, geometry is recreated carefully using precise references. This reduces the risk of inconsistencies that often appear in manual redrawing.

Maintains Proper Layers and Dimensions

One of the biggest limitations of PDFs is the lack of structure. Everything sits flat- no layers, no hierarchy, no separation between elements. In CAD, that structure matters.

Walls, grids, annotations, dimensions, all need to sit on defined layers. It’s what allows teams to coordinate effectively across disciplines.

When drawings are converted professionally, layers are rebuilt logically, and dimensions are placed accurately. That alone improves how teams interact with the drawings.
